“O programa não existe” ao tentar usar o “ip” com o Monit

0

Estou tentando reiniciar o openvpn no meu namespace usando monit.

O comando que eu uso da linha de comando funciona bem:

 ip netns exec vpn openvpn --daemon --config /etc/openvpn/vpn.conf

Mas quando tento usá-lo no monitor, ele diz:

/etc/monit.d/monitrc:3: Program does not exist: 'ip'

Como faço para chamar o comando IP ou onde ele é encontrado para o caminho?

    
por JavajoeUK 24.11.2016 / 19:00

1 resposta

0

Você precisa fornecer o caminho completo para ip . Para encontrar o caminho, use which ip .

Às vezes, o comando type é uma boa alternativa para which , então você também pode tentar. type diria se ip foi alias para outra coisa, por exemplo.

    
por 24.11.2016 / 21:33

Tags